About The Position

Intermountain Medical Center is seeking a motivated Radiology Student with a Limited Scope Radiology License to join our Imaging team on a PRN, as-needed basis. In this role, you will perform diagnostic imaging procedures within the scope of your state licensure while working under the guidance and support of experienced imaging professionals. This position offers an excellent opportunity to further develop your clinical skills, enhance your patient care experience, and prepare for a successful career as a Registered Radiologic Technologist. This is intended as a temporary position only, with the expectation that the caregiver will advance to the Radiology Tech Reg position as soon as possible. It is expected that employees do not remain in this position longer than six months after completion of clinical hours.

Requirements

  • Currently enrolled in a JRCERT or AMA-approved school of radiologic technology with documented completion of clinical and didactic training as required by state regulations.
  • Current Limited Scope Radiology License in the state of practice.
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) for healthcare providers.

Responsibilities

  • Perform all diagnostic procedures within Scope of Practice under the supervision of a Registered Radiologic Technologist.
  • Practices within the scope of state licensure.
  • Maintains ARRT or modality-specific competency in all clinical and technical functions.
  • Ensures proper patient identification, order verification, and prepares the patient for the exam.
  • Performs exams per department protocol and reviews images for quality, clarity, and accuracy.
  • Adheres to radiation safety guidelines and maintains a safe working environment.
  • Completes studies within acceptable time limits without compromising patient care or quality.
  • Provides appropriate patient education, ensures patient comfort, and addresses concerns.
  • Practices appropriate infection control and sterile techniques.
  • Understands and operates equipment and related information systems to ensure quality images.
  • Keeps accurate records of patient information, procedures performed, and any adverse reactions.
  • Follows protocols for medical necessity, coding, charging, consents, QC programs, and reporting equipment failures.
